two billion, four hundred ninety-nine million, nine hundred ninety-seven thousand, nine hundred ninety
Currency CA$2499997990 in canadian english: two billion, four hundred ninety-nine million, nine hundred ninety-seven thousand, nine hundred ninety Canadian dollar.
In Price: 2499997990.00
2399997990 | 2599997990